How we sound

Glossary

of common terms

You can use this glossary to check how we write common Girlguiding terms and words.

A

1st response

Not First Response (our first aid training scheme)

1 team

Number 1 then lower case on team

5 essentials

Number 5 then lower case for our 5 guiding principles

activities

Use in relation to the programme only

activity theme

Lower case

adviser

Not advisor. Lower case for role

advocate panel

advocates (people). Lower case for both

Anglia region

Girlguiding Anglia region is 1 of 9 countries and regions in Girlguiding. Initial capitals for place names. Lower case on ‘region’. Region can be dropped where appropriate

annual subscription

Lower case

area

Lower case (a broad term for our districts, regions, counties, countries and divisions)

a safe space

Lower case - if this might be confusing in a sentence, use a more straight talking word like training or resources. Write levels in lower case: level 1, level 2, level 3

assistant leader

Lower case for role

award

Lower case when referring to awards in general. Capitalise the names of specific awards, but not the word award itself: Laurel award role

B

badge

Lower case when talking about badges in general and when describing specific badges: active response badge

BAME

Avoid this term – say people of colour instead. As much as possible, refer to ethnic groups individually, rather than as a single group, such as Black Caribbean people.

be well

Lower case for the programme theme

Beaver Scouts

Beavers

Initial capitals (Scouts 6-8-year-olds)

Big Gig

Both words capitalised for the name of this event

board of trustees

the board

Lower case

British Overseas Territories

Girlguiding British Overseas Territories is a county within the Girlguiding North West England region

Bronze award

First word only capitalised

Brownie

Brownies

First word only capitalised. Initial capital when referring to the 7-10-year old section

Brownie buddy

Brownie helper

Brownie holiday

Initial capital on Brownie only. Not Brownie pack holiday.

Brownie unit

Not Brownie pack

C

chief commissioner

Lower case

chief guide

Lower case

climbing and abseiling scheme

Lower case

code of conduct

Lower case in running text. First word only capitalised at the start of a line (on the title page, for example)

commissioner

Lower case

cooperate

Not co-operate

coordinator

Not co-ordinator

county, country

Lower case, even when referring to the Girlguiding area

Covid

Not Covid-19 or COVID-19 or coronavirus

Cub Scout

Cubs

Initial capitals (Scouts 8-10-year-olds)

Cymru (Wales)

Girlguiding Cymru (Wales). Initial capitals for place names. Always use Cymru when referring to this country. 1 of 9 countries and regions in Girlguiding.

D

DBS check

disclosure check

Either use the abbreviation (stands for Disclosure and Barring Service check) or the simple term. Only the abbreviation uses capitals

disabled girl or person

Instead of girl or person (living) with a disability

district district assistant district commissioner

Lower case

doing our best

Lower case – if this might be confusing in a sentence, use a more straight talking word like standards or checklist

Duke of Edinburgh’s Award

Name of award is capitalised in line with DofE style.

After the first mention, can be abbreviated to DofE


E

ecard

elearning

email

enewsletter

Without hyphens

emergency file

Lower case

Explorer Scouts

Explorers

Initial capitals (Scouts 14-18-year-olds)

express myself

Lower case for the programme theme

Back to top

F

fair trade

Lower case and 2 words when describing the general movement

Fairtrade

1 word with initial capital to refer to the official trademarked name

first aid

first aider

Lower case

founders

Lower case. Used to refer to our founders, Robert Baden-

Powell and Agnes Baden-Powell

Free Being Me

Each word capitalised for this module from the peer education programme

fundraising

Lower case

G

Girlguiding UK

Use only in a global context

Girlguiding qualified trainer

Lower case to refer to someone who delivers training and has their trainer qualification

Girlguiding shop

We can also refer to this as our volunteer shop. Don’t use the term trading to refer to the shop.

Girlguiding’s strategy or our strategy

Lower case on strategy. We no longer say strategy 2020+

Girls’ Attitudes Survey

Initial capitals. Don’t use the abbreviation GAS externally

GO

Capitals for the abbreviation of our membership system (Guiding Organiser)

going away with licence or scheme

Lower case

Gold award

First word only capitalised

good turn

Lower case

government

Lower case

Guide

Guides

Initial capital for our 10-14-year-old section. Use only in relation to the members of this section – when referring to everyone say ‘all girls in Girlguiding’ not girl guides

The Guide Association

The legal/financial entity – only use when necessary: for example, ‘please make cheques out to The Guide Association’

Guide camp permit

First word only capitalised

Guide law

Only Guide capitalised

guiding

Guiding is what we do (verb). Lower case, except when it’s in a sentence with Scouting (Guiding and Scouting) or a global context (World Guiding)

guiding magazine

Lower case
